Bharat Won’t Bend to Terror: Amit Shah Assures Families of Pahalgam Victims

adminBy adminApril 23, 2025

Union Home Minister Amit Shah has strongly condemned the recent terror attack in Pahalgam, Jammu and Kashmir, and assured the families of the victims that the nation stands firmly with them. Emphasizing the government’s zero-tolerance policy toward terrorism, Shah declared, “Bharat will never bend before terror. The blood of innocents will not go in vain.”

The brutal attack, which occurred over the weekend, claimed the lives of several civilians, including women and children, in a targeted ambush near a popular tourist route in Pahalgam. It has reignited national outrage and sorrow, drawing swift responses from political leaders across party lines.

In his address to the media on Tuesday morning, Shah expressed his deep condolences and pledged strong retaliatory action against the perpetrators. “This cowardly attack is an attempt to disrupt peace and development in Jammu and Kashmir. But I want to assure the nation that we will bring the culprits to justice,” he said.

The Home Minister also spoke directly with the families of the victims via video call, offering them support and promising swift compensation and assistance from the central government. Security forces have since intensified combing operations in South Kashmir, with elite units deployed to track down those responsible.

Reiterating the Centre’s commitment to eliminating terrorism from Indian soil, Shah stated, “Those who think they can weaken India’s resolve with bullets and bloodshed are gravely mistaken. We have strengthened our security apparatus and will continue to do so until terrorism is wiped out completely.”

Political analysts note that this incident marks a critical moment for the ongoing efforts to stabilize the region. In the wake of the attack, Prime Minister Narendra Modi also condemned the violence, assuring citizens that “the sacrifice of the victims will not go unanswered.”

The Ministry of Home Affairs is expected to hold a high-level meeting this week with intelligence and military officials to assess the situation and formulate a revised strategy for counterterror operations in the Valley.

Meanwhile, the nation continues to mourn the victims of the Pahalgam tragedy. Candlelight vigils have been held in several cities, with citizens demanding justice and stronger measures to prevent such attacks in the future.

As the situation unfolds, Amit Shah’s resolute words serve as both a warning to enemies of the nation and a reassurance to its citizens: India will not bow to terror.
